Dendrodoris elongata

Haleiwa Trench, Oahu, 30 feet

 

ELONGATE NUDIBRANCH

Rare on reefs exposed to surge.  Elongate, gray, tan, or dull yellow with rows of brown blotches and ragged white papillae.  Attains 4.75 inches.  Hawaii, Indo-Pacific, and Tropical Eastern Pacific.  Formerly known as Dendrodoris albobrunnea.
